SFPE Handbook | Ch. 14 | Eq. 14.2 & 14.3
HRR for heat detector response
Calculates the heat release at which a heat detector submerded in the ceiling jet will activate
Reference
Hurley, M.J., et al., 2016. SFPE Handbook of Fire Protection Engineering. 5th ed. Springer.
Equations
\dot{Q} = \left((T-T_\infty) \cdot \dfrac{H^{\frac{5}{3}}}{16.9}\right)^{\frac{3}{2}}
or
\dot{Q} = \left(\dfrac{(T-T_\infty) \cdot \left(\dfrac{r}{H}\right)^{\frac{2}{3}} \cdot H^{\frac{5}{3}}}{5.38}\right)^{\frac{3}{2}}
